Abstract
The dielectric properties of the grain of hard red winter wheat cv. Gage, sorghum cv. NC+ Hybrid T700 and spring oats cv. Neal, and seeds of soyabean cv. Wayne and lucerne cv. Ranger were measured with 7 systems covering the frequency range 250Hz-12GHz. Data are also given for the protein, crude fat and ash content of the grains and seeds
